Anthropic and Cisco have announced an integration that brings AI threat detection directly into Claude Enterprise. The partnership leverages Anthropic's inference hooks—a new capability that lets organizations send each governed prompt to a security service before the model runs—and routes those prompts to Cisco AI Defense, which inspects them for artificial intelligence threats and returns a verdict of allow or deny.
The core problem this solves is a gap in traditional security. As Claude Enterprise users increasingly deploy Claude, Claude Code, and Claude Cowork to act on their behalf—reading documents, calling tools, and running tasks—the prompt itself becomes an attack surface. A jailbreak can attempt to bypass the assistant's guardrails. A prompt injection hidden in a shared file can hijack an agent and turn its own tools against the organization. Traditional data loss prevention tools were built to watch for sensitive data leaving the building; they were never built to see the model being manipulated. That is the exposure Cisco AI Defense targets.
Cisco AI Defense reads intent, not just data. When a user submits a prompt to Claude Enterprise, it is passed to Cisco AI Defense through the inference hook, which inspects the full conversation—including tool calls and their results—against the organization's runtime policy for prompt injection, jailbreaks, tool exploitation, and sensitive data. Every call is cryptographically verified with a one-time signing secret, and Cisco AI Defense confirms authenticity before inspection. A verdict is returned before inference: safe prompts continue; a malicious prompt is blocked, and the model never runs.
The availability timeline shows the integration is live for Claude Enterprise today, with inference hooks currently in beta. The hook fires on each governed prompt before the model runs, which is where enforcement currently happens. As Anthropic extends the hook to responses, the same integration path will enable response-side enforcement. Over time, the enforcement is expected to become a native part of the Cisco AI Defense Inspect API, allowing users to enable it with a few steps in their Claude Enterprise settings. Cisco offers a live playground in its developer portal where users can enter a prompt and watch the real-time inspection and verdict in action.
